PHILLIPS, Circuit Judge.
Heyne Service Station, Inc.,1 a Nebraska corporation, brought an action against F. G. Spencer and Bertha Spencer to recover damages to a gasoline transport. Henry M. Madsen brought an action against the Spencers to recover damages for personal injuries. The damages to the gasoline transport and to Madsen resulted from the same accident.
